What problem does it solve?

This playbook helps teams validate an offer pillar hypothesis by finding, recruiting, and interviewing the people closest to the pain so decisions are based on quantified signals rather than assumptions. It replaces scattershot outreach and anecdotal feedback with a repeatable discovery pipeline that produces a pain proximity map, target list, outreach plan, interview protocol, and a decision-ready synthesis.

Core Features & Use Cases

  • Pain Proximity Mapping: Identify roles with the highest insight density and prioritize high-value interview targets.
  • Target List & Outreach Plan: Build a 30–50 person target list across LinkedIn, conferences, vendor ecosystems, and consultants with channel-specific expected response rates and message templates.
  • Interview Protocol & Extraction Templates: Standardized opening questions, probe sequences, post-interview extraction fields, and rules for rejecting low-quality signals.
  • Signal Detection & Synthesis: Rules for identifying pillar-validating and pillar-killing signals, saturation rules, pattern analysis tables, and validation thresholds with explicit quality gates and a 3-interview stop rule.
  • Use Case: Early-stage product teams, founders, or PMs who need to validate problem hypotheses, refine positioning, or determine willingness-to-pay before building.
